Window Frame Replacement
It's possible to fix the window frame if there is damaged window panes or if you are planning to upgrade your home. The average cost of repairing fiberglass frames is around $300, whereas wooden frames tend to be more expensive. A professional glazier can offer an accurate assessment of your needs at present and recommend the best option for you.
Resealing your aluminum frame can be the cheapest option. The material is tough however it expands and twists as time passes. The glazing can crack and break due to this, making it necessary to have professionals repair the aluminum windows. They typically use clear plastic to repair the cracks and restore your window back to its original state.
Wooden models are also prone to rotting and cracking especially after prolonged exposure to elements. The most common issue is rot, but holes can appear due to swelling or shrinking from temperature changes. Holes are more frequent on wooden frames that are older and they are generally easier to repair than cracks.
Composite frames are usually made of a mixture of wood, plastic, laminated wood and plastic with fibers embedded. They are a popular option for homeowners as they don't require much maintenance, but they're also less likely to last as long as wooden models. They can face issues such as fogging between the glass panes, which is best left to a professional.

Window Glass Replacement
Window glass replacements are a very popular home improvement project since they can boost the appearance and efficiency of your home. It's also a good solution for those who require an easy fix for a broken or cracked window pane. If you're replacing a number of windows in your home it is recommended to consult a professional. This will ensure that you have the best outcome for your budget and lifestyle.
A window glass replacement could be as easy or complex as you need it to be. window repair near me in a window should be no problem for a skilled homeowner or glazier to repair and the cost is usually around 70 dollars per window on average. If however, the entire window is leaky or letting in too much air, then replacing the entire window might be more appropriate.
Other issues that may require window replacement or repair are damaged or missing exterior casings, or mullions and muntins that are splitting or rotting. Also windowsash seals and cords might need to be repaired or replaced.
A few indications that need a new window include fog and condensation between double or triple paned windows. These are indications that a seal is failing which allows air to leak in and out and causing higher energy bills. It is possible to increase the insulation of windows and reseal old ones by replacing the seal.
It is recommended to use laminated window glass for new windows as it is more robust. It also reduces the amount UV radiations that can enter the home. It is less likely to break, and can also to reduce noise as well as air infiltration. The cost of laminated glass window will vary based on the size and style of window.
